Craft distilleries are a trend not only in Indiana but across the entire country. While they are not yet as prominent as wineries or breweries in the state, they are certainly becoming more common among emerging businesses in the alcohol industry. Distilleries are using locally grown products to create their spirits, and consumers are looking to support their efforts. From sweet corn whiskey to limoncello, we want you to experience the unique and delicious craft spirits that are being distilled in all corners of the state.

To help you do just that, Indiana Grown has created our very own Distillery Trail featuring 18 of our member distilleries. Not only are the distilleries members of Indiana Grown but so are many of the farms growing the ingredients used in production, which creates a unique collaboration from grain to glass.

How it Works

Download your own copy of the Indiana Grown Distillery Trail. Get a stamp at each location and return the completed map by mail to:

Indiana State Department of Agriculture
Attn: Indiana Grown
One N. Capitol Ave. Suite 600
Indianapolis, IN 46204

You will receive a custom Indiana Grown coaster as a thank you for supporting local!

Please note:

This trail only represents Indiana Grown member distilleries and is not an exhaustive list of distilleries in Indiana.

As new members join the Indiana Grown Distillery Trail, we will post updates periodically, however, all versions of completed maps will be accepted.

Participants may visit any location to receive a stamp for those distilleries denoted as having multiple locations. There is no time limit to complete the trail.
